Output c38402ac53c003ce79bdd08c59ef277a5891ff9cf89d315b1ce606d200a1d1fb:28

value
404776
script pubkey
OP_0 OP_PUSHBYTES_20 aaa11001b67edd1eb5215de7ee96182438f676ab
address
bc1q42s3qqdk0mw3adfpthn7a9scysu0va4tk8vgpa
transaction
c38402ac53c003ce79bdd08c59ef277a5891ff9cf89d315b1ce606d200a1d1fb
confirmations
142405
spent
true